Understanding ADHD Private Diagnosis: Navigating the Path to Clarity and Support
Attention Deficit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that affects countless individuals worldwide. With signs varying from inattention and hyperactivity to impulsivity, ADHD can significantly affect every day life, scholastic efficiency, and interpersonal relationships. While lots of people are familiar with the signs of ADHD, fewer understand the procedure of obtaining a private diagnosis. This article intends to shed light on ADHD private diagnosis, its value, the steps involved, and some frequently asked questions.
Why Seek a Private Diagnosis for ADHD?
In a lot of cases, people seeking an ADHD diagnosis face long waiting times through public health systems. Private diagnosis options offer a number of advantages, including:
Reduced Waiting Time: One of the primary benefits of looking for a private diagnosis is the reduced waiting time compared to public psychological health services.Versatile Appointment Scheduling: Private practitioners may offer more flexible consultation times, allowing people to arrange assessments that fit their schedule.Comprehensive Assessment: Private assessments are typically more extensive, including a detailed expedition of signs, behavioral patterns, and their effect on every day life.Access to Specialized Professionals: Many private adult adhd diagnosis centers employ experts in ADHD who can offer tailored treatment plans and continuous support.Greater Control: Patients often have more control over their care in a private setting, including picking the clinician and the type of assessment.The Process of Obtaining a Private Diagnosis
Navigating the private diagnosis procedure for ADHD generally involves several essential steps. These steps might vary depending upon the expert or center, however normally consist of:
1. Initial Consultation
Throughout the preliminary consultation, individuals meet a certified clinician, such as a psychologist or psychiatrist. This consultation may include:
Discussing signs and issues.Evaluating individual and household case history.Finishing preliminary surveys.2. Comprehensive Assessment
Following the initial assessment, the clinician might advise an extensive assessment. This might consist of:
Standardized surveys: Various ADHD-specific assessments are often utilized to collect details about signs and their impact.Interviews: Clinicians might speak with household members, instructors, or other substantial individuals in the individual's life to get extra insights.Behavioral observations: Some practitioners perform direct observations in different settings (home, school, etc) to much better comprehend behavioral patterns.3. Diagnosis and Treatment Plan
After completing the assessment, the clinician will evaluate the data to figure out if the individual meets the criteria for an ADHD diagnosis. If a diagnosis is verified, the next actions may include:
Discussing treatment alternatives, which may include medication, therapy, or lifestyle modifications.Developing a personalized management strategy to support the person's particular requirements.Setting up follow-up appointments to keep track of progress and make modifications as needed.4. Ongoing Support and Monitoring

Early diagnosis and intervention are vital for people with ADHD. Research reveals that adults with unattended ADHD might face difficulties such as:
Academic underachievement.Employment troubles.Problems in individual relationships.Increased danger of comorbid conditions (e.g., anxiety or anxiety).
By looking for a private diagnosis, people can access early interventions and support, enabling them to manage their symptoms efficiently and improve their lifestyle.
Frequently Asked Questions About ADHD Private Diagnosis1. Just how much does a private ADHD diagnosis cost?
The cost of a private ADHD diagnosis can differ commonly based upon area, the clinician's experience, and the comprehensiveness of the assessment. Typically, it can range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 2,500. It's essential to ask about costs in advance and check if your insurance covers any part of the assessment.
2. Is a private diagnosis as legitimate as a public diagnosis?
Yes, a private diagnosis is considered simply as valid as a public diagnosis if carried out by a certified and competent specialist. Both kinds of assessments generally follow recognized diagnostic criteria.
3. Can I get treatment instantly after a private diagnosis?
Oftentimes, people can start treatment quickly after receiving a private diagnosis. Nevertheless, this depends upon the clinician's suggestions and the person's specific requirements and circumstances.
4. What role do parents play in the ADHD diagnosis procedure for children?
For children seeking a private diagnosis, parents play a vital role by offering comprehensive information about their child's behavior and experiences, both in the house and in school. This input is vital to clinicians throughout the assessment process.
5. What kinds of experts can detect ADHD?
ADHD can be identified by different certified experts, including psychologists, psychiatrists, pediatricians, and accredited therapists trained in ADHD assessment.
